Comprehensive Service Overview

When a garage door stops working properly in Balsam, the nature of the problem often ties back to the local environment. Spring repairs are among the most common issues here. The high-tension springs that lift heavy wooden or insulated doors can wear out faster in climates with big temperature swings, and when they snap, the door becomes unsafe to operate manually. Cables can fray or break from rust, and the rollers may wear unevenly if the track has shifted due to ground movement.

Opener problems are also frequent. In areas where power flickers during mountain storms, the circuit boards in units from brands like LiftMaster, Chamberlain, or Genie can sometimes need reprogramming or replacement. Remote keypads and wall controls may lose their connection, and safety sensors can get knocked out of alignment from small shifts in the concrete or frost heave.

Off-track doors happen too—especially on sloped driveways where the door is occasionally bumped by vehicles or where snow and ice push against the bottom seal. Getting a door back on track involves careful work to avoid damaging the panels or bending the tracks further.

For homeowners in Balsam, a typical repair visit starts with identifying the problem, then discussing options before any work begins. Many choose to replace worn springs and cables in pairs to keep the system balanced. A multi-point check of rollers, tracks, sensors, and balance is commonly included to make sure everything is working as it should before the technician leaves. Workmanship warranties are standard, giving homeowners confidence that the repair will hold up through the seasons.

Why Choose a Local Pro?

Garage door repair in a mountain community like Balsam is different from the same job in a flat, suburban neighborhood. The homes here sit on varying foundations, some of which have settled or shifted over decades. Driveway grades affect how a door tracks, and the local climate puts unique stress on metal components, seals, and openers.

Because building codes and installation practices have changed over the years—especially in older mountain homes that were built as seasonal cabins—no two garage doors are quite the same. Someone familiar with the area will know what to look for: rust patterns common to high-humidity zones, foundation movement from freeze-thaw cycles, and the quirks of doors installed on angled or uneven concrete.

Taking the time to find someone who understands these local conditions can make a real difference in how well a repair holds up. It's less about finding any technician and more about finding the right fit for the specific property.

Regional Characteristics

Balsam sits at a higher elevation in Jackson County, where the climate brings cold winters, frequent freeze-thaw cycles, and significant humidity in warmer months. Many homes in the area were built as seasonal cabins or vacation properties and have been converted to year-round residences, meaning their garage structures vary widely in age and condition. Driveways are often steep and gravel, and garage layouts can be tight or unconventional due to the mountainous terrain. Newer developments tend to feature standard two-car garages, while older properties may have single-car or detached structures that require more specialized attention.

Common Issues

Freeze-thaw cycles can cause track misalignment and sensor issues as the ground shifts beneath concrete slabs. Moisture and humidity lead to rust on springs, rollers, and cables over time. Snow and ice buildup around the bottom seal can cause doors to freeze shut or put extra strain on openers. Power fluctuations from mountain storms commonly affect opener circuit boards and remote programming. In older homes, garage doors may be original to the structure and approaching the end of their service life.
